Comprehending Pallet Storage
Pallets are flat structures used to support items in a steady type while being raised by forklifts or pallet jacks. Effective pallet storage includes enhanced plans and systems that permit fast access and taken full advantage of usage of area. Numerous elements influence the pallet storage method, consisting of warehouse size, item type, and the circulation of goods.
Table 1: Overview of Common Pallet Storage Methods
| Storage Method | Description | Advantages | Downsides |
|---|---|---|---|
| Selective Racking | The most straightforward system enabling access to each pallet. | High accessibility, flexible style | Lower storage density |
| Drive-In Racking | Forklifts drive into the racks to store Pallets For Sale. | Takes full advantage of space, suitable for high-volume products | Limited access to pallets, higher setup expense |
| Push-Back Racking | Comparable to drive-in but utilizes a cart system that pushes pallets back. | More available than drive-in, multi-depth storage | Needs specialized devices |
| Pallet Flow Racking | Uses gravity to move Wood Pallets Sale through the rack. | First-in, first-out (FIFO) inventory management | Higher preliminary investment |
| Mobile Racking | Racks installed on tracks that can move, permitting for more storage capacity. | Maximizes area while keeping access options | High expense and complex setup |
Aspects Influencing Pallet Storage Design
The design of a pallet storage system must be affected by different vital aspects:
- Type of Goods: Different items have special storage needs. Heavy or large products may require stronger racking systems, while smaller items might be saved in compact shelving.
- Warehouse Layout: A well-thought-out design is vital for ensuring effectiveness. The design ought to help with simple access to often picked products to reduce travel time.
- Inventory Turnover: High-turnover items must be easily available, while slow-moving goods can be stored in less accessible locations.
- Security Standards: Compliance with security regulations and warehouse requirements is necessary for preventing mishaps and liabilities.

How to Optimize Pallet Storage
To maximize the benefits of pallet storage, warehouses must concentrate on optimizing their systems. Here are some strategies:
- Use the Right Racking System: Assess the kinds of products saved and choose a racking system that optimizes area while permitting simple access.
- Implement FIFO or LIFO Systems: Determine whether a First-In, First-Out (FIFO) or Last-In, First-Out (LIFO) approach would work best for your stock and follow it consistently.
- Take advantage of Technology: Incorporate warehouse management systems (WMS) to automate and enhance stock tracking and placement.
- Regular Audits: Conduct routine inventory audits to identify slow-moving products or products that need reorganization. This assists in preserving performance.
- Train Staff: Ensure that all personnel members are trained in the best practices for storage and retrieval, emphasizing office safety.
